Prins is a color adjustment photo editor. You do not need an account to use it. Your edits, presets, and history are handled on your device with local storage.

Prins uses system permissions so you can select or capture photos. When you grant access, the app reads the images from your device, applies your chosen adjustments, and prepares the exported result.

You can clear history and manage presets from within the app UI. If you delete an item, the related saved files can also be removed.
Exporting an edited image may require available credits in your app profile. Credits can be increased through in-app purchases handled by Apple on iOS.
You should only edit and export photos you have the right to use. Prins is a creative tool, and your choices determine how you use your results.
If something looks wrong with an export, try changing fewer adjustments, verifying your selected photo, or exporting again.
